We invite you to join our wonderful team and be part of our purpose: Improving life for all by integrating the world.Join us and play an important role on our team lifting global trade every day!We are now looking for a Global Head, Gateways and 3rd Party Agents to join Air Freight Forwarding team. Reporting to a Global Head of Airfreight, you are responsible for overseeing and ensuring effective operations of a global network of Import/Export Gateways, as well as establishing Global Gateway Policy, managing tactical procurement , establishing a cost-effective structure and generating a monthly balanced scorecard to drive GP improvement, cost management and service improvements. Ownership of all 3rd party agents, relationships, profitability and growth.What we offerBy Joining Maersk, you will become part of the global family of the company that moves 20% of global trade everyday all the way, where one of our core values is Our Employees. It goes without saying that we value diversity: we thrive on the diversity of our talent in all its forms, and we see it as a strength in building high-performance teams across brands, cultures, and locations.Besides focusing on creating value for our customers and the business, a key priority for us is to drive personal and professional development for our people to prepare for further career progression.Flexibility: Work location can be flexibleKey ResponsibilitiesEnsure process and staffing standardization across all Gateway OperationsCreate Balanced Scorecard for each operation and align key measurables to be reported on a monthly basis – establish improvement goals for each criteria – by GatewaySet GP improvement goals through optimizing the building of large effective consolidations and relentless tactical procurementEnsure operational alignment among global gatewaysCreate Global Gateway Policy – mandatory use unless approved exceptions (DG, Express etc) Measure to ensure complianceOptimize volume flows objective of achieving best possible lowest net achieved costs and respective promised transit timesExecute, design and optimize road feeder structure to feed and de-feed stations to Gateway (Import/Export)Coordinate/measure with countries to ensure gateway routing discipline and that routing guides is adhered toEstablish new consol destination as requiredEnsure compliance to all regulatory requirements – CFS / ScreeningStrong inclusion in RFQ pricing processMaintain / Develop relationships with Global Third Party AgentsSupport the Airfreight Growth within our agency network though education, pricing and sales supportCreate the needed measurements to assess growth in agent business and GP within the Maersk NetworkEstablish GP/Tonnage Growth targets for top 10 agents – with ongoing monthly measurements.Assess 3rd party Agent financial and operational performanceActively participate in carrier data driven performance reviewsResponsible and ensure effective CW implementation and ongoing process managementOwnership of the ISO9001-2015 standard as pertains to gateways effectiveness.What we look forA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ent work experience is requiredAt least 15 years of experience in positions of increasingly responsibility airfreight industryProven track record with air carriers in the marketAbility to work within a team and communicate with both internal and external stakeholders in a professional mannerAbility to manage workload independently and with attention to deadlinesMaersk is committed to a diverse and inclusive workplace, and we embrace different styles of thinking.
